#ff7d14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ff7d14 is composed of 100% red, 49%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 53.9%. #ff7d14 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a28 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#ff7d14 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ff7d14 has RGB values of R:255, G:125,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.92, K:0. Its decimal value is 16743700.

Shades and Tints of #ff7d14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fff4ec is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ff7d14 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#989898 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#ad937e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#baa629 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d09e00 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ff7e85 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d39721 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e19207 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ff7d5b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
